How are proteins and nerve cells related?

A single neuron contains about 50 billion proteins– these proteins are needed for the essential functions of the neuron but also exploited to change how the neuron responds to inputs- a process called synaptic plasticity . Changes in the proteins present at synapses underlie learning and memory.

Do your muscle and nerve cells make the same proteins?

Some proteins are the same in most cells: muscle cells and nerve cells need to build common structures like mitochondria. But there are also unique ingredients in both cell types: a muscle cell needs special proteins that let the muscle cells move during contraction. These are called myosin and actin.

What proteins do neurons make?

The specialized proteins typically produced by neurons include enzymes that catalyze (speed-up) reactions leading to the metabolism of molecules essential to neuronal function, such as neurotransmitters and carrier or signal proteins of the plasma membrane.

What part of a nerve cell makes proteins?

neuron ER Endoplasmic reticulum is a labyrinthine, membrane bounded compartment in the cytoplasm where lipids are synthesized and membrane bound proteins are made. In some regions of the neuron ER is devoid of ribosomes and is termed smooth ER.

How are proteins released from cell?

In contrast, the proteins that will be secreted by a cell, such as insulin and EPO, are held in storage vesicles. When signaled by the cell, these vesicles fuse with the plasma membrane and release their contents into the extracellular space.

What makes proteins in a cell?

To build proteins, cells use a complex assembly of molecules called a ribosome. The ribosome assembles amino acids into the proper order and links them together via peptide bonds. This process, known as translation, creates a long string of amino acids called a polypeptide chain.

When protein is produced in the cell?

The information to produce a protein is encoded in the cell's DNA. When a protein is produced, a copy of the DNA is made (called mRNA) and this copy is transported to a ribosome. Ribosomes read the information in the mRNA and use that information to assemble amino acids into a protein.
